Getting Started with Stacks

Stacks is designed to be user-friendly, making it easy for developers to get started. The process begins by heading to the platform and signing up. Once registered, navigate to the settings to add your API keys. This step is essential as it allows the platform to interact with your preferred AI model. After setting up your API keys, you can proceed to add a new project.

Setting Up Your Project

When creating a new project, you have the option to choose from different evaluation methods. For instance, you can opt for pointwise evaluation, which involves assessing each response individually. This method is particularly useful for detailed analysis. Once you choose your evaluation method, you'll be directed to the evaluation section. Here, you can select the model based on your API. For example, if you are using OpenAI, you would choose that model. After selecting the model, you need to provide system instructions. In a demo, the instructions were set to simulate a travel agent, and travel-related questions were used as queries. Each output can then be rated by giving a thumbs up or thumbs down, providing a clear indication of the AI's performance.

Efficient Evaluation with CSV Uploads

For those with larger datasets, Stacks offers a convenient feature: CSV file uploads. Instead of evaluating queries one by one, you can simply upload a CSV file containing your entire dataset. This feature is a significant time-saver, allowing developers to evaluate multiple responses at once. After uploading the CSV file, click on "generate all." Choose the model you prefer, and Stacks will generate outputs for all the queries. The platform then automatically evaluates these outputs based on predefined criteria such as verbosity (whether the answer is too long, too short, or just right), usefulness, and text quality. This automated process ensures that all queries are tested and evaluated efficiently, saving developers considerable time and effort.
